The Origins of Datalounge
Datalounge began as an online discussion forum dedicated to topics of interest primarily to the LGBTQ+ community. Originally, it provided a safe and discreet space where users could share experiences, opinions, and gossip without fear of real-world repercussions. Over time, it evolved into a more general pop culture forum, attracting individuals interested in celebrity news, media analysis, and community debate. The forum operates on a structure that encourages anonymity, which fosters honest opinions and sometimes heated debates. Unlike social media platforms that thrive on likes and shares, Datalounge’s format emphasizes discussion threads and the nuanced exchange of ideas. Its longevity can be attributed to this blend of discretion, specialized focus, and a community that values both wit and insider knowledge.

Anonymity and Its Implications
A key feature of Datalounge is its commitment to user anonymity. While some may view anonymity as a breeding ground for trolling, in Datalounge’s case, it has facilitated open discussion and the sharing of sensitive or controversial perspectives. By removing the pressure of real-world identity, users feel freer to express opinions on controversial topics, from celebrity scandals to political commentary. This anonymity also enhances the forum’s reputation as a space where users can explore topics without fear of public judgment. However, it does require members to exercise critical thinking and discernment, as the lack of accountability can sometimes result in misinformation or heated disputes.
